目的 :研究牛蒡子及其提取物对链脲佐菌素 (STZ)糖尿病大鼠尿蛋白、尿微量白蛋白、肾脏TGF β 1mRNA和MCP 1mRNA表达的影响。方法 :以链脲佐菌素 (STZ)诱导的糖尿病大鼠为动物模型 ,中药治疗组分别给予牛蒡子粉饲料、牛蒡子水提物、醇提物进行 6周的实验 ,观察了大鼠的一般状况 ,尿蛋白、尿微量白蛋白及肾功能变化 ,聚合酶链反应 (RT PCR)方法测定肾皮质TGFβ1、MCP 1mRNA的表达。结果 :牛蒡子提取物能明显改善STZ大鼠多饮、多食和消瘦 ,降低尿蛋白、尿微量白蛋白 ,减少肾组织转化生长因子 β1(TGF β1)mRNA、单核趋化蛋白 1(MCP 1)mRNA的表达。 结论 :牛蒡子提取物对糖尿病大鼠肾脏病变有一定的改善 ,其作用机制可能与降低尿蛋白、尿微量白蛋白及肾脏TGF β1和MCP 1mRNA的表达有关 ,研究表明
AIM: To investigate the influence of Fructus Arctii and its extracts to the renal pathological changes of diabetic rat and its protective mechansim METHODS: The rat model induced by 55mg/kg STZ once intraperitoneally was adoped as the diabetic nephropathy of early stage, the extract and the powder of Fructus Arctii were given to the diabetic rat for six weeks. We observed the changes of general condition, and examined the expressions of TGF-β 1 (transforming growth factor-β 1) mRNA and MCP-1mRNA (monocyte chemoattractant protein-1) by reverse transcription-polymerase chain reaction (RT-PCR). CONCLUSION: The ethanol extract of Fructus Arctii relieved renal pathological changes of diabetic rat. The mechanism perhaps was related to the reduction in the expression of MCP-1mRNA and TGF-β 1mRNA in kidney; The study proved that the ethanol extract of Fructus Arctii was more effective than its water extract and coarse powder.
